Could you repower a 782 with an engine from an LT1550? It's the 25 horse twin cylinder Koehler engine.
|
with enough skill and know how you can do anything, the command 18 and 20hp engines are popular engine to repower a 782.
|
I don't think so!
If I am correct, the engine in a newer LT series is a vertical shaft that runs a drive belt. The 782 is a two cylinder, horizontal shaft engine that is connected to a drive shaft. There is not a way that I know of that allows one to tip a vertical shaft engine and make it horizontal. The engine will not oil itself. At the moment, I am working on a 782 as well. Good luck with your project. |

I looked at it again, and it would seem that the 1550's engine is a Kohler Courage 25, which is a vertical shaft. Guess I won't be going that route then...
|
I'd say even a Mag 12, like from a 1211 would be just peachy depending upon how well your search goes for the other engines.
|
According to what Ive read on Brian Millers sites both the Kohler Command pro and the B+S Vanguard twins can be converted from vertical to horizon shaft positions. You have to do some modifications but apparently it has been done for pulling tractors. I'd like to try once myself.
